MI HB6096Land use: zoning and growth management; site plan; prohibit requirements for repeat studies. Amends sec. 501 of 2006 PA 110 (MCL 125.3501).

Bill Summary
A bill to amend 2006 PA 110, entitled"Michigan zoning enabling act,"by amending section 501 (MCL 125.3501), as amended by 2008 PA 12.
AI Summary
This bill amends the Michigan Zoning Enabling Act to specify that local governments may require the submission and approval of a site plan before authorizing a land use or activity regulated by a zoning ordinance. The bill requires that the site plan, as approved, be included in the record of approval, and that subsequent actions relating to the authorized activity must be consistent with the approved site plan. The bill also specifies the procedures and requirements for the submission and approval of site plans, including the use of a completed site plan application form that lists any required studies or documents and applicable technical standards. The bill limits the circumstances under which the local government can require the applicant to submit additional or revised studies or documents.
